AEMO has concluded a consultation on B2B Procedures on behalf of the Information Exchange Committee (IEC).

The publication of this final report concludes the Information Exchange Committee’s (IEC) Minor Rules consultation process under clause 8.9.4 of the National Electricity Rules.

This consultation sought to consolidate previously consulted on issues, with additional minor clarifications to address queries raised by industry.

The IEC proposed to amend relevant versions of the B2B Procedures to:

  1. Consolidate previously consulted on changes associated to the following items which were concurrently consulted on in 2025
    1. The implementation of the Accelerating Smart Meter Deployment (ASMD) Rule of the Australian Energy Market Commission (AEMC), specifically, Basic Power Quality Data.
    2. The removal of technical content from the applicable procedures.
    3. The implementation of the AEMC’s Final Rule for 'Unlocking CER benefits through flexible trading' (FTA).
  2. Remove ambiguity in Table 13 of the Service Order Process Procedure to ensure the correct treatment of the RegClassification
    1. Mandatory for MSW SORs (Meter Install, Meter Exchange and Install Meter Isolation Device) and not required for SSWs sent to DNSPs, in line with the original consultation intent
  3. Remove an incorrect inclusion of a new ReasonForInter value of ‘Appointment’ in the B2B Guide
    1. Inadvertently included in the ‘Establish a Secondary Settlement Point at a Large (8a) or Small (8b) customer’ diagram
  4. Correct an error in referencing in Table 3 of the Service Order Process Procedure
  5. Clarify the Service Order Process Procedure requirements applicable to the installation of a customer-supplied Type 9 meter
